Ternary Phase Diagrams 101 Diagrams A ternary phase diagram is a graphical representation of the phases that exist in a system composed of three components. it is a useful tool in understanding the behavior of systems with multiple components, such as alloys, mixtures, or geological systems. by studying a ternary phase diagram, one can determine the composition of phases at. A ternary phase diagram consists of three axes, each representing the composition of one component in the system. the diagram is divided into regions that represent different phases, such as solid solutions, compounds, and eutectic mixtures. the boundaries between these regions are called phase boundaries or phase lines.
